Transaction e5887d7dbe79ee2619db54a3ddc084d21794e73ac3385d4c54fb30c606e8589c
1 Input
1 Output
-
e5887d7dbe79ee2619db54a3ddc084d21794e73ac3385d4c54fb30c606e8589c:0
- value
- 335768
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bd9900900dfc596132e70c5e3601c64ef0f57838 OP_EQUAL
- address
- 3JyWvaXKvXadCrd6iay5vi89S6rzoHGPwN